La Vuelta is known as one of the most unforgiving and exciting cycling races with an ever-evolving route designed to make and break its competitors in their quest to claim the coveted red winners’ jersey. This year, the race departs from Barcelona on 26 August before arriving in Madrid on 17 September after more than 3,100km of sprints, time trials and mountains. 

One of the strongest casts of protagonists riding for red in 2023 sees three-time Vuelta winner Primoz Roglic join teammate and two-time Tour de France winner Jonas Vingegaard to battle defending Vuelta champion Remco Evenepoel as well as Grand Tour winners Geraint Thomas and Egan Bernal.
